Fix buffile.c error handling.
Convert buffile.c error handling to use ereport. This fixes cases where I/O errors were indistinguishable from EOF or not reported. Also remove "%m" from error messages where errno would be bogus. While we're modifying those strings, add block numbers and short read byte counts where appropriate. Back-patch to all supported releases.
